41SM301-T2 Equivalent & Substitute Parts Reference
Part Overview
The 41SM301-T2 is a snap action SPDT switch manufactured by Honeywell Sensing and Productivity Solutions. This chassis mount switch features a round pin plunger actuator with solder turret termination, rated for 11A at 250V AC and 5A at 30V DC. The product is classified as obsolete, making equivalent and substitute parts necessary for ongoing maintenance, repair, and new design applications where this component is specified or functionally required.

Substitute Part Grouping Explanation
Substitution of the 41SM301-T2 is determined by the following critical parameters that must be matched or exceeded:
Electrical Parameters:
- Circuit configuration must be SPDT
- Switch function must be On-Momentary
- Current rating must support the application voltage and amperage requirements
- Voltage ratings (AC and DC) must meet or exceed application specifications
Mechanical Parameters:
- Actuator type must be round pin plunger for physical compatibility
- Mounting type must be chassis mount
- Operating position of 0.330" (8.4mm) must be maintained for mechanical fit
- Termination style compatibility with circuit board or assembly design
Environmental & Compliance:
- Operating temperature range must encompass application requirements
- RoHS compliance status must be verified for regulatory adherence
- Mechanical life rating should be considered for application duty cycle
The substitute parts identified are grouped into two categories based on electrical capability:
Category A - Lower Current Capacity (2A AC/DC): ABS1410409, ABS1410503, ABS1410509 (Panasonic Electric Works). These parts are suitable only for applications where the 41SM301-T2 is specified but actual current requirements do not exceed 2A.
Category B - Comparable Current Capacity (10A AC): DB2CA1AA (ZF Electronics). This part approaches the current handling capability of the original part at 10A AC, suitable for 125V AC applications.
Category C - Incomplete Specification: DB1C-A1AA and DC3C-A1AA (Hirose Electric Co Ltd). These parts lack sufficient technical documentation to establish full substitution compatibility.

Engineering Selection Recommendations
For Direct Replacement in High-Current Applications (≥10A AC at 250V):
The DB2CA1AA from ZF Electronics provides the closest electrical performance match with 10A AC rating at 125V. However, this part operates at a lower voltage rating than the original 41SM301-T2 (125V AC versus 250V AC). The DB2CA1AA is suitable only for applications where the actual operating voltage does not exceed 125V AC. This part is currently active in production and carries ROHS3 compliance certification.
For Lower-Current Applications (≤2A AC/DC):
The Panasonic Electric Works ABS series switches (ABS1410409, ABS1410503, ABS1410509) are suitable substitutes for applications where current requirements do not exceed 2A. All three variants maintain the same SPDT circuit configuration, on-momentary function, round pin plunger actuator, and 0.330" operating position. These parts are currently active and RoHS compliant. The primary differences among the three ABS variants are operating force (100gf for ABS1410409 versus 150gf for ABS1410503 and ABS1410509) and release force specifications.
Termination Compatibility Consideration:
The original 41SM301-T2 features solder turret termination, while all identified substitute parts use solder lug termination. Circuit board or assembly design must accommodate this termination style difference.
Temperature Range Limitation:
The Panasonic ABS series operates within -40°C to 85°C, which is narrower than the original part's -55°C to 125°C range. Applications requiring operation below -40°C or above 85°C cannot use these substitutes. The DB2CA1AA extends to 120°C, providing better high-temperature coverage.
Product Status:
All identified substitute parts carry active product status, ensuring ongoing availability and supply chain continuity compared to the obsolete 41SM301-T2.
Frequently Asked Questions (FAQ)
Q: Can the ABS1410409, ABS1410503, or ABS1410509 directly replace the 41SM301-T2 in all applications?
A: No. These Panasonic switches are suitable only for applications where the actual current requirement does not exceed 2A. The original 41SM301-T2 is rated for 11A at 250V AC. If your application requires currents above 2A or voltages above 125V AC, these parts are not compatible.
Q: What is the difference between ABS1410409, ABS1410503, and ABS1410509?
A: All three parts share identical electrical ratings (2A AC/DC at 125V), circuit configuration (SPDT), and mechanical specifications (0.330" operating position, round pin plunger, chassis mount). The differences are in operating force (ABS1410409 at 100gf versus 150gf for the other two) and release force values (15gf versus 20gf). Selection depends on the specific actuation force requirements of your application.
Q: Is the DB2CA1AA a suitable replacement for high-current applications?
A: The DB2CA1AA provides 10A AC rating, which is closer to the original 11A AC rating. However, it operates at 125V AC maximum, not 250V AC. This part is suitable only for applications operating at 125V AC or lower. If your application requires 250V AC operation, the DB2CA1AA is not compatible.
Q: Why do the substitute parts use solder lug termination instead of solder turret?
A: Solder lug termination is the current industry standard for snap action switches. Solder turret termination, used on the original 41SM301-T2, is less common in modern production. Circuit board or assembly modifications may be required to accommodate solder lug termination.
Q: Can I use these substitute parts in applications with temperature extremes?
A: The original 41SM301-T2 operates from -55°C to 125°C. The Panasonic ABS series is limited to -40°C to 85°C. The DB2CA1AA extends to 120°C. If your application requires operation below -40°C or above 85°C (for ABS parts) or above 120°C (for DB2CA1AA), these substitutes are not suitable.
Q: What is the mechanical life difference between the original and substitute parts?
A: The original 41SM301-T2 is rated for 80,000 mechanical cycles. The Panasonic ABS series switches are rated for 5,000,000 cycles, and the DB2CA1AA is rated for 10,000,000 cycles. All substitute parts exceed the original part's mechanical life specification.
Q: Are all substitute parts RoHS compliant?
A: Yes. The Panasonic ABS series parts carry RoHS compliance certification. The DB2CA1AA carries ROHS3 compliance certification. All identified substitutes meet RoHS regulatory requirements.
